static bool si_mark_divergent_texture_non_uniform(struct nir_shader *nir)
{
assert(nir->info.divergence_analysis_run);
/* sampler_non_uniform and texture_non_uniform are always false in GLSL,
* but this can lead to unexpected behavior if texture/sampler index come from
* a vertex attribute.
*
* For instance, 2 consecutive draws using 2 different index values,
* could be squashed together by the hw - producing a single draw with
* non-dynamically uniform index.
*
* To avoid this, detect divergent indexing, mark them as non-uniform,
* so that we can apply waterfall loop on these index later (either llvm
* backend or nir_lower_non_uniform_access).
*
* See https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/issues/2253
*/
bool divergence_changed = false;
nir_function_impl *impl = nir_shader_get_entrypoint(nir);
nir_foreach_block_safe(block, impl) {
nir_foreach_instr_safe(instr, block) {
if (instr->type != nir_instr_type_tex)
continue;
nir_tex_instr *tex = nir_instr_as_tex(instr);
for (int i = 0; i < tex->num_srcs; i++) {
bool divergent = tex->src[i].src.ssa->divergent;
switch (tex->src[i].src_type) {
case nir_tex_src_texture_deref:
case nir_tex_src_texture_handle:
tex->texture_non_uniform |= divergent;
break;
case nir_tex_src_sampler_deref:
case nir_tex_src_sampler_handle:
tex->sampler_non_uniform |= divergent;
break;
default:
break;
}
}
/* If dest is already divergent, divergence won't change. */
divergence_changed |= !tex->dest.ssa.divergent &&
(tex->texture_non_uniform || tex->sampler_non_uniform);
}
}
nir_metadata_preserve(impl, nir_metadata_all);
return divergence_changed;
}
